The duration of a journey by air between Miami International Airport (MIA) and Tocumen International Airport (PTY) is influenced by several factors. These include the specific route taken by the aircraft, prevailing weather conditions, air traffic control directives, and the type of aircraft. Non-stop flights generally offer the quickest travel option. Connecting flights, while potentially offering cost savings, often extend the overall travel duration due to layovers and transfers.
